HIPAA (Health Insurance Portability and Accountability Act) - Compliant Software Development Checklist 2024
Published 19 July 2024
Technologies
By Elite Digital Team
Understand HIPAA Requirements
- Privacy Rule: Protects the privacy of individually identifiable health information.
- Security Rule: Sets standards for the security of electronic protected health information (ePHI).
- Breach Notification Rule: Requires covered entities and business associates to provide notification following a breach of unsecured PHI.
- Enforcement Rule: Contains provisions relating to compliance and investigations, the imposition of civil money penalties, and procedures for hearings.
Why HIPAA Compliance is Essential for Healthcare Apps
1. Legal Obligation
2. Patient Trust and Confidence
3. Protection Against Data Breaches
4. Competitive Advantage
5. Prevent Penalties and Reputation Damage:
6. Enhanced Data Management and Security
HIPAA compliance requires the implementation of stringent data management and security protocols. This includes regular audits, risk assessments, and continuous monitoring of systems to ensure the integrity and confidentiality of PHI. These practices not only protect patient data but also enhance the overall security posture of your organisation. By adhering to HIPAA standards, you establish a robust framework for managing and securing sensitive information, which can be beneficial in the long term.
Ensuring HIPAA compliance for your healthcare app is not just a regulatory necessity; it is a critical aspect of protecting patient data, maintaining trust, and positioning your app for success in the competitive healthcare market.
A Comprehensive Guide to the HIPAA Framework
Before diving into the specifics, it’s crucial to have a clear understanding of HIPAA’s requirements. HIPAA consists of several rules that must be adhered to:
- Privacy Rule: Regulates the use and disclosure of PHI.
- Security Rule: Sets standards for securing electronic PHI (ePHI).
- Breach Notification Rule: Requires notifications in the event of a breach of unsecured PHI.
- Enforcement Rule: Provides guidelines for compliance investigations and penalties.
Which Types of Healthcare Apps Require HIPAA Compliance?
HIPAA compliance is essential for healthcare apps that handle Protected Health Information (PHI). Key types of apps requiring compliance include:
- Telemedicine Apps: Secure video and messaging platforms for remote consultations.
- EHR Systems: Electronic systems for managing patient health records.
- Health Monitoring Apps: Devices and apps that track health metrics and chronic conditions.
- Prescription Management Apps: Tools for managing medication schedules and prescriptions.
- Health Insurance Apps: Platforms for managing claims and insurance information.
- Patient Portals: Apps providing access to personal health data and appointment information.
- Clinical Decision Support Tools: Systems aiding healthcare providers in clinical decision-making.
- Mental Health Apps: Apps offering therapy, counselling, or mental health assessments.
Ensuring HIPAA compliance for these apps involves implementing strong data protection measures to safeguard patient information.
HIPAA Compliance Checklist for Software Development
Ensuring your software adheres to HIPAA (Health Insurance Portability and Accountability Act) standards is crucial for protecting sensitive patient information. Here’s a concise checklist to guide you through the process:
- Conduct a Risk Assessment
- Identify and evaluate potential risks to Protected Health Information (PHI).
- Develop a plan to address and mitigate identified risks.
- Implement Data Encryption
- Use strong encryption methods for data both at rest and in transit.
- Ensure encryption protocols meet industry standards for security.
- Establish Access Controls
- Implement robust authentication and authorization measures.
- Restrict access to PHI based on roles and responsibilities.
- Maintain Audit Trails
- Keep detailed logs of all data access and modifications.
- Regularly review audit trails to detect and address unauthorised activity.
- Adopt Secure Development Practices
- Follow secure coding standards and practices during development.
- Regularly update and patch software to fix vulnerabilities.
- Sign Business Associate Agreements (BAAs)
- Ensure that third-party vendors handling PHI sign BAAs.
- Define and enforce compliance responsibilities in these agreements.
- Conduct Regular Testing and Updates
- Perform security testing and vulnerability assessments periodically.
- Update software to address new security threats and maintain compliance.
- Provide User Training
- Educate users on HIPAA requirements and data protection best practices.
- Ensure that staff are aware of their responsibilities in safeguarding PHI.
By following this checklist, you can develop software that meets HIPAA requirements and effectively protects sensitive health information.